Located in the charming coastal town of Morro Bay, City Park is a hidden gem that offers a perfect blend of relaxation and recreation for both locals and visitors alike. This over-sized pocket park has recently undergone a revitalization, making it a must-visit destination for dog owners looking for a peaceful retreat in the heart of the city. Upon entering City Park, visitors are greeted with a beautifully refurbished basketball court, perfect for a friendly game or shooting some hoops with friends and family. The park also boasts newly installed picnic tables and benches, providing the ideal spot for a leisurely outdoor meal or a quick snack while enjoying the fresh coastal breeze.

A convenient drinking fountain ensures that both humans and their furry companions stay hydrated during their visit. One of the highlights of City Park is the play area, which features an arch swing, a twisting tube slide, and a spacious climbing structure that will keep children entertained for hours. The park’s thoughtful design caters to families looking to spend quality time together in a safe and welcoming environment. In addition to its recreational amenities, City Park also pays tribute to history with a poignant World War II Memorial Monument, offering visitors a moment of reflection and remembrance amidst the park’s serene surroundings.

One of the standout features of City Park is its dog-friendly policy, welcoming four-legged friends on leash to explore and enjoy the park alongside their owners.
